How Police Benevolent Associations: Improving Lives in West Palm Beach Actually Works
At a basic level, a police benevolent association is a support group for officers and their families, but its role in the community can be much broader than many people realize. In West Palm Beach, local chapters may host workshops on financial planning, offer peer counseling after difficult incidents, and coordinate holiday toy drives for families in need. They often act as a bridge between the police department and civilians, helping both sides better understand each otherβs challenges. This makes Police Benevolent Associations: Improving Lives in West Palm Beach a practical resource rather than a political symbol.
From a beginnerβs perspective, imagine a patrol officer who experiences a traumatic call. Instead of facing the aftermath alone, they can reach out to their benevolent association for confidential guidance, access to mental health professionals, or even temporary financial assistance while they take time to recover. For residents, this can translate into safer streets, because supported officers are better able to serve calmly and professionally. Programs may also include youth mentorship, where off-duty officers spend time at community centers, helping young people build positive relationships with law enforcement. Things People Often Misunderstand
One common myth is that these associations only exist to defend officers in difficult situations. In reality, many modern benevolent groups emphasize training, mental health, and community projects far more than confrontation. They often partner with schools, nonprofits, and local businesses to create programs that benefit everyone. When people learn this, they may begin to see Police Benevolent Associations: Improving Lives in West Palm Beach as a stabilizing force rather than a controversial one.
Another misunderstanding is that involvement is only for sworn officers. Family members, volunteers, and even concerned residents can participate in fundraising, event planning, and outreach activities. By broadening participation, associations can strengthen their ties to the community and show that their mission is about collective well-being.
